Our wonderful tour guide from our Jeep excursion brought us to Gold Rock Beach, easily one of the most breathtaking beaches I have seen in my travels. He explained that the rock formation in the water we could see from the shore looks golden in the rising and setting sun, after which the beach was named. The water was crystal... more

This beach in a part of Lucayan National Park. It's a short easy hike from the parking lot, which also has 2 underground caves as a part of this Lucayan National Park. The short hike across the mangrove, walking on the board walk. Once we got to the beach, what we saw in front of us is just breathtaking! Nice... more
